Introduction: The Self-Hosting Dilemma

Self-hosting—the practice of deploying applications on personal hardware rather than relying on cloud services—has gained traction as a strategy to regain control over personal data and reduce dependency on subscription-based models. The allure is straightforward: ownership of infrastructure grants autonomy, eliminates recurring fees, and enhances privacy. However, the viability of self-hosting hinges on a critical trade-off: the balance between utility and the sustained effort required for maintenance. Not all self-hosted applications deliver equal value, and their long-term feasibility varies significantly based on the services they replace.

The central challenge lies in quantifying the return on investment of maintenance effort. Self-hosting demands ongoing vigilance—server hardware degrades, software updates introduce incompatibilities, and security vulnerabilities require prompt patching. The decisive factor is whether the application’s benefits outweigh these recurring costs.

The Pattern: Paid Replacements vs. Free Replications

A consistent pattern emerges from years of self-hosting experience: applications replacing paid subscriptions consistently justify their maintenance overhead due to tangible financial savings and enhanced data sovereignty. For instance, Nextcloud displaces Google Drive and Photos, eliminating $10–$20 monthly subscription fees. While initial setup—configuring SSL certificates, ensuring data synchronization, and establishing backup protocols—is resource-intensive, the long-term financial and privacy benefits render it a strategic imperative. Similarly, Vaultwarden (a Bitwarden alternative) negates password manager subscription costs, and Jellyfin permanently eliminates media streaming fees. These applications deliver measurable returns through cost avoidance and enhanced control over personal data.
